The table lists information about four devices. A 4 column table with 4 rows. The first column is labeled device with entries W,

X, Y, Z. The second column is labeled wire loops with entries 60, 40, 30, 20. The third column is labeled current in milliamps with entries 0.0, 0.2, 0.1, 0.1. The last column is labeled metal core with entries yes, yes, no, no. Which lists the devices in order from greatest magnetic field strength to weakest? W, X, Y, Z W, Z, Y, X X, Z, Y, W X, Y, Z, W

Answer:

X, Y, Z, W

Explanation:

W has a current of 0 so it has no magnetic field.

X has the most loops (besides W) and the most current so it is the strongest.

Y and Z are the same except Y has more loops so it is stronger than Z.
